PD Photo: De eerste familie (The first family), 1589 oil on canvas painting by the Dutch Golden Age painter and draughtsman Cornelis van Haarlem (Cornelis Corneliszoon van Haarlem, 1562-1638); dimensions 125 cm x 143 cm (49.21 x 56.30 inches), location at Musée des Beaux-Arts de Quimper, depicting Adam and Eve taking care of Cain and Abel. The painting was in the private collection of Jean-Marie-François-Xavier Comte de Silguy, France until 1864 since when it came to the collection of Musée des Beaux-Arts de Quimper.
